Understanding ADHD: The Role of the Psychiatrist in Diagnosis and Treatment
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that affects both kids and grownups. It is identified by relentless patterns of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ity that disrupt operating or advancement. As ADHD gains increased acknowledgment in numerous age groups, the role of psychiatrists in identifying and treating this condition has actually ended up being critical. This post looks into how psychiatrists approach ADHD, the techniques they use, and the significance of detailed treatment plans.
What is ADHD?
ADHD is frequently classified based upon its primary symptoms into 3 main types:
Predominantly Inattentive Presentation: Difficulty arranging jobs, following detailed guidelines, and preserving attention.Primarily Hyperactive-Impulsive Presentation: Excessive fidgeting, talking, trouble waiting their turn, and disrupting others.Combined Presentation: Symptoms of both negligence and hyperactivity/impulsivity exist.
Here's a table summing up the signs based upon the presentations:

Psychiatrists play a crucial function in the assessment, diagnosis, and management of ADHD. Their training in mental health permits them to differentiate ADHD from other psychological conditions and assess its effect on a person's everyday functioning.
Steps Involved in ADHD Assessment
Scientific Interview: The private psychiatrist cost uk should perform an in-depth medical interview with the affected individual (and, if applicable, their household). Concerns generally concentrate on the duration and seriousness of symptoms, family history, and influence on functioning.
Standardized Rating Scales: The usage of standardized scales like the ADHD Rating Scale or Conners' Parent Rating Scale can assist quantify signs and evaluate their seriousness.
Behavioral Observations: Observing behaviors in various settings (home, school, or work) supplies insights into how ADHD manifests throughout contexts.
Collateral Information: Input from instructors, member of the family, or other caretakers can supply additional point of views on the individual's behavior.
Eliminate Other Conditions: The psychiatrist must examine whether symptoms are because of other mental health conditions, physical health problems, or environmental aspects.
Treatment Options Offered by Psychiatrists
As soon as detected, a psychiatrist private practice may recommend a variety of treatment choices tailored to the individual's needs:

Non-stimulant medications, such as atomoxetine (Strattera), may be advised for those who do not respond well to stimulants or experience inappropriate side impacts.
Psychotherapy: Behavioral therapy can help people establish coping strategies, time management skills, and enhance self-confidence.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T) has also been revealed to be effective in handling symptoms.
Psychoeducation: Educating clients and their families about ADHD assists them comprehend the condition and encourages partnership in treatment.
Lifestyle Modifications: Psychiatrists might advise strategies to enhance day-to-day regimens, such as setting structured schedules, adopting healthy eating practices, and taking part in regular exercise.
Support Groups: Connecting patients and households with ADHD support groups can offer emotional support and useful advice from peers.
Significance of an Interdisciplinary Approach
Handling ADHD frequently requires a multi-faceted strategy. Psychiatrists regularly collaborate with psychologists, social employees, instructors, and primary care doctors to make sure extensive care. This team method promotes much better interaction and supplies a wide variety of viewpoints on treatment.

Can ADHD just be identified in childhood?
ADHD can stay undiagnosed till the adult years. Lots of adults might have dealt with undiagnosed symptoms, which can lead to difficulties in work, relationships, and self-confidence.

3. How can medication assist manage ADHD signs?
Medication can assist manage neurotransmitters in the brain, leading to enhanced attention, impulse control, and hyperactivity levels. Medication must be one part of a broader treatment strategy.
4. What are the side effects of ADHD medications?
Some common negative effects of stimulant medications include sleeping disorders, appetite reduction, and increased heart rate. Non-stimulant medications might have various effects, such as fatigue or intestinal upset.
5. Is treatment essential for ADHD treatment?
While medication can be efficient, therapy is often advised to equip individuals with abilities and strategies to cope with daily difficulties resulting from ADHD.
